>>>>> On Thu, 29 Aug 2019 11:56:27 -0500, Alex Branham <alex.branham <at> gmail.com> said:

    Alex> Hi -
    Alex> After the recent NSM update gnus fails to open my mail with this message:

    Alex> Warning: Opening nnimap server on LocalMail...failed: ; Unable to open server nnimap+LocalMail due to: Buffer  *nnimap localhost nil  *nntpd** has no process

    Alex> My setup is that I use mbsync/isync to download the mail and run dovecot
    Alex> read the maildir and host it as an imap server. Since it's local it's
    Alex> not encrypted. Setting network-security-protocol-checks to nil does not
    Alex> change anything. I've only recently started using dovecot/gnus so it's
    Alex> possible I've done something silly but it was working before the NSM
    Alex> update (at commit ef8531d262081d91ecf2a4f349bc63a0fede90d4) and isn't
    Alex> working as of 4b87169d113a151e5d9d6cf7b0d7cb4fb1d3d2d7.

Can you show us your Gnus configuration? Also, what is your
'network-security-level' set to?
